MIR4636
Summary
MIR4636 is a non-coding RNA[1].
Key Facts
- MIR4636's instance of is recorded as non-coding RNA[2].
- MIR4636's instance of is recorded as gene[3].
- MIR4636 is a type of non-coding RNA[4].
- MIR4636's genomic start is recorded as 9053816[5].
- MIR4636's genomic start is recorded as 9053928[6].
- MIR4636's genomic end is recorded as 9053895[7].
- MIR4636's genomic end is recorded as 9054007[8].
- MIR4636's found in taxon is recorded as Homo sapiens[9].
- MIR4636's chromosome is recorded as human chromosome 5[10].
- MIR4636's strand orientation is recorded as reverse strand[11].
- MIR4636's exact match is recorded as http://identifiers.org/ncbigene/100616326[12].
- MIR4636's cytogenetic location is recorded as 5p15.31[13].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as blood[14].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as endometrium[15].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as gastrocnemius muscle[16].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as spleen[17].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as left ventricle[18].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as stomach[19].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as myometrium[20].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as islet of Langerhans[21].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as human kidney[22].
- MIR4636's expressed in is recorded as anterior cingulate cortex[23].
